Sisu: Road to Revenge review: Go big to get home

Our Verdict

Sisu: Highway to Revenge fires on all cylinders from begin to end. Director Jalmari Helander heard our cries for a film that goes tougher than the primary, delivering in each facet with motion set items which are to die for. Coupled with Jorma Tommila and Stephen Lang’s performances and an impeccable rating, there are actually only a few issues to be stated towards this revenge-ridden sequel.

You ever surprise what would occur if Mad Max Fury Highway met the Quick and the Livid franchise? That, my pals, is Jalmari Helander’s Sisu: Highway to Revenge.

If I had every week, I couldn’t inform you all the methods Helander’s sequel goes balls-to-the-wall for almost each second of its runtime. Although, to be truthful, I wouldn’t wish to. Highway to Revenge is a kind of movies that’s completely important to look at on the most important display attainable, with the biggest crowd that you’ll find, and with as few precise particulars as attainable. 

The primary movie is nice, following Aatami Korpi (Jorma Tommila) on his journey to money in gold via Nazi occupied Finland, however it’s not nice. It delivers on the brutality it promised, however every part concerning the first movie – which, to be clear, I loved – left me wanting extra.

Highway to Revenge is that “extra” after which some, with the first motive that you might want to see it within the theater being that you simply need to hoot and holler on the display the way in which the Incredible Fest crowd did as Aatami completely mows via anybody standing in his approach. There are not less than three objects in my notes with about 15 underlines beneath them as a result of the second was so large.

Second verse a lot bolder than the primary

Appropriately, Highway to Revenge’s journey is just a little bit totally different than the primary movie’s. It’s extra private, which solely makes the violence all of the extra delightfully earned. Highway to Revenge takes place in 1946 – two years after the unique. Aatami has returned to the shell of his residence, the place his household was brutally murdered throughout WWII. The saddened, battle-tired soldier slowly demolishes the house piece by piece, taking care to meticulously stack the lumber on the again of a truck with the intent to take it to Finland and rebuild to dwell out the remainder of his days along with his trusty pup. 

And the Soviet Military – significantly Igor Draganov (Stephen Lang) – took that personally. 

You see, Draganov is the person who slaughtered Aatami’s household, chopping them up piece by piece to save lots of ammunition. He was captured on the finish of the conflict, and he doesn’t take too kindly to the truth that Aatami has turn out to be a legend throughout the land. Draganov is launched and granted the complete weight of the Reds with a purpose to cease The Koshchei (The Immortal) from reaching his purpose of peace. Can’t have a man who embarrassed your troopers maintain respiratory whenever you’re dwelling in an influence vacuum, in spite of everything. After all, Draganov goes to search out Aatami far more tough to finest than his defenseless spouse and youngsters.

Sisu: Highway to Revenge is cut up into 5 chapters, every yet another delightfully unhinged than the final. The set items on this movie are impeccable in essentially the most superbly chaotic approach attainable. It amps up each single facet of the primary movie, each within the hazard Aatami and his trustworthy pup face, and absolutely the hell he unleashes on those that wronged his household and dare to face in the way in which of his purpose.

See also  SwitchBot Curtain Rod 2 review

Most significantly, although, is that it seems good doing it. The entire motion is nonsensically excessive, however it seems so good that I totally believed a single man may accomplish all the issues Aatami does with a powerful grasp of physics and a can-do angle. Nonetheless, others might discover it tougher to purchase into.

As I alluded earlier, it’s not simply the amplified motion that makes Sisu: Highway to Revenge greater and higher than its predecessor, however the coronary heart as nicely. Tommila delivers one other fully silent efficiency (he has a single line on the finish of Sisu, however there aren’t any closing phrases from the warrior this go round), this time along with his character’s disappointment taking part in simply as crucial of a job as his rage.

Earlier than he was a person simply making an attempt to money in his gold. Now he’s a person simply making an attempt to rebuild after conflict ravaged his area and destroyed his household. He’s slaughtered a whole lot of Nazis and quite a lot of Reds. He’s drained, his canine is drained, and so they simply need some well-earned peace. That longing performs via in spades, and is superbly woven with the disappointment that comes together with all of his incomparable loss.

Aatami seems on, decided to achieve his vacation spot.

Magnificence in sound, and the silence

The juxtaposition of violence and disappointment within the script require one hell of a rating. The composer isn’t listed anyplace simply but (the movie doesn’t launch worldwide till 21 November 2025) however they did one hell of a job elevating each second of the motion. Each sweeping and startling, the music of Sisu: Highway to Revenge is crucial to elevating its lead’s speechlessness and the motion’s explosivity. 

Whereas bombastic at each flip, it’s Sisu: Highway to Revenge’s ending that finally ends up being the in the end pièce de résistance. To offer any narrative hints would do each you and the movie a disservice, however the place the remainder of the movie is loud, it’s quiet. Frankly, it’s additionally a billion different adjectives that might, sadly, give an excessive amount of away. Suffice to say that you simply go to conflict with Aatami throughout the 2 movies and, in the long run, his closing moments are an totally good expertise for anybody who’s been alongside on the journey.

Do you have to watch Sisu: Highway to Revenge?

Sisu: Highway to Revenge ended up being my absolute favourite movie of Incredible Fest, and it was up towards stiff competitors with the likes of Black Telephone 2, Good Luck, Have Enjoyable, Don’t Die, and One Battle After One other. It’s large in each approach it must be large, and small within the ways in which it must be small. Jorma Tommila’s efficiency is each neck and heart-breaking, and Stephen Lang is ever the right monster on display. Jalmari Helander completely outdid himself right here – simply be ready for an actual wild experience.

Sisu: Highway to Revenge hits theaters 21 November 2025. UK followers can pre-order tickets from Odeon and Vue, whereas US followers can get them from Atom Tickets and Fandango.
